As Harry Jowsey prepares to face his former lovers head-on in an upcoming explosive 'Let's Marry Harry' reunion episode, we're taking a look at the woman who he plans to spend the rest of his days with.
The Netflix reality dating series 'Let's Marry Harry' follows Harry, who's known for his playboy antics on Too Hot to Handle and The Perfect Match, as he embarks on a quest to find his wife. During the show, which was filmed between October 15 and November 20, 2025, Harry met 20 eligible women who were ready to walk down the aisle.
After building strong connections and breaking the hearts of many of the contestants, Harry now has to encounter them face-to-face as he attends the reunion episode, perming on Netflix August 26. While Harry and the final contestant did exchange vows, they do have intentions to in the future. After filming wrapped, Harry revealed that their marriage paperwork was intentionally held back by production to prevent public spoilers, meaning they are not yet legally married.
While their love is not legally binding, the pair did share a beautiful ceremony on the final episode of the Netflix series which was officiated by his close friend, Amanda Kloots. As Harry prepares to confront his former lovers, here is everything we know about Harry's soon-to-be wife.
Who is Harry Jowsey's wife?'

Harry's soon-to-be wife is Amber Mozo -Credit:Netflix
Harry will be marrying Hawaii-based travel photographer Amber Mozo after falling in love on the reality series.
Sparks flew after Harry, 29, and Amber, 30, got to know one another on the Netflix show. The pair were at the center of controversy at one point after going to his room for a one-on-one talk, which ultimately led to an intimate moment in the shower after they hid from the cameras. This later led to issues with the other contestants after Harry lied to them about the moment.

Amber's life before the show

Amber works as a photographer in Hawaii -Credit:Netflix
Outside the show, Amber works as a photographer, capturing surfers riding the waves on the beautiful islands of Hawaii.
Her bio on the Club of the Waves website reads, "Living on the islands of Hawaii her whole life, photographer Amber Mozo has grown up around the ocean. She lives and breathes the sea. Inheriting a love of surfing and photography from her late father, Jon Mozo — a surf photographer himself — she’s made it her mission to travel the world, taking photos along the way."
At the beginning of the season, Amber also shared that she had been married once before. She married Colby Hollingsworth, an account executive at Makai Fruits in Hawaii, in 2016, when she was just 19 years old. The pair later filed for divorce after three years of marriage.
She shared that she also grew up as a practicing Mormon, but no longer believes in the religion.
What has Harry said about the upcoming Netflix reunion?
Harry has posted a number of TikToks joking about the upcoming reunion in the wake of numerous women on the show bashing his behavior and leading them on.
One viral clip circulating on TikTok is Harry superimposing his face on a soldier running through a war zone, along with the song Battlefield by Jordin Sparks playing in the background, along with the caption, "HOW I'M ARRIVING TO THE REUNION."
In another one, Harry seemed to be shading one of the contestants as he posted a video of himself scratching his head, with the caption, "no beef, just confused how much shi you talking about someone you knew for 10 mins over a year ago." While he didn't name any names, fans are expecting plenty of drama from the reunion, including hearing what this contestant has to say about Harry's behavior.
Another point of contention was when Samantha 'Sam' Kruse left the house after discovering Harry hadn't been entirely honest about being intimate with Amber. Fans are also eager to hear from Danelle, who was one of the finalists and the runner-up to be Harry's wife. Many felt that her exit was brutal and are looking forward to hearing everything she has to say about the experience.
